Update On Lars Sullivan's WWE Status

NXT's 'Freak' was supposed to debut on the main roster in January...

Lars Sullivan was supposed to make his WWE main roster debut earlier this year. If reports are to be believed, The Freak was to injure John Cena, ruling the 16-time World Champion out of this year's men's Royal Rumble match before facing the leader of the Cenation in a career-making match at WrestleMania 35.

However, a heavily reported anxiety attack postponed Lars' first main roster appearance and we haven't really head much about him since. Thanks to Dave Meltzer in the latest Wrestling Observer Newsletter, we have the latest update on Sullivan's WWE status.

Lars will be returning "imminently" according to Meltzer. Even though he hasn't been able to provide a timescale, Dave says it's going to be "sooner than later."

Rumours persist suggesting Sullivan could be getting involved in John Cena's match on Sunday. While nothing official has been announced for John, he is in New York this weekend and has allegedly agreed to wrestle a surprise opponent at some point during the bumper 15-match card.
